Colombo > Nuwara Eliya
Bluefield Tea Gardens - Explore a Tea Factory and plantation to witness the production of the world-renowned “Ceylon Tea.” In 1824, the British brought a tea plant from China to Ceylon, planting it in the Royal Botanical Gardens in Peradeniya for non-commercial purposes. James Taylor, a British national, introduced commercial tea plantations to Sri Lanka (Ceylon) in 1852, settling in the Loolecondera estate in Kandy. Today, even those unfamiliar with Sri Lanka recognize Ceylon tea for its superior quality.

Nuwara Eliya > Galle
Galle - Later in the day, explore the city of Galle, where the Portuguese and Dutch established their headquarters, uncovering its secrets. Visit the Galle Fort, one of Asia’s best-preserved fortifications. Discover the Maritime Museum, Galle National Museum, and the lighthouse. Wander through cobblestoned streets with Dutch names, learning about their rich histories.
Handunugoda Tea Estate - Tour the Handunugoda Tea Factory, also known as the Virgin White Tea Factory. Discover the history of the tea produced here and learn how the renowned Virgin White Tea is harvested and processed without human contact. Enjoy a tasting session with a delightful cup of tea and delicious chocolate cake. Purchase some tea leaves as a memorable souvenir.
Galle > Negombo
Kosgoda Sea Turtle Conservation Project - Visit the Kosgoda Turtle Hatchery on Sri Lanka’s Southwestern coast. Learn about the five endangered sea turtle species that nest on Sri Lanka’s shores. Discover how the Kosgoda Turtle Care Program protects nests until they hatch, increasing the survival chances for the hatchlings. Experience the opportunity to see, touch, and feed baby turtles, or even care for injured adult turtles at the Hatchery.
Madu Ganga Biodiversity Area - Embark on a delightful boat ride along the Madu River, home to a thriving ecosystem. Navigate through secretive mangrove passages, observe basking crocodiles and water monitors, and visit small islands with cinnamon-harvesting locals. Enjoy the rejuvenating fish massage and watch waterbirds in their natural environment.
